Dam Fish Hatchery

We found a new dam good spot to stop on our trips between Bend and Eugene. We never realized there was a fish hatchery on the other side of the Leaburg dam. You have to drive over the dam which is exciting for Linus, who loves a good bridge (and a good dam for that matter). They also have a pond full of the biggest Sturgeon I have ever seen in all my life. Seriously, they were probably bigger than me. The boys loved throwing stinky handful of fish pellets into churning clumps of oddly aggressive fish. And I enjoyed a break from being stuck in the car with them.
